Transaction b5156fe81f89f81771fc367505aa3e1a1f96f68ae49644a343d7ff7f01968245

1 Input
2 Outputs
  • b5156fe81f89f81771fc367505aa3e1a1f96f68ae49644a343d7ff7f01968245:0
  • value  1052082
    address  15r4SiZ53WCgSuh28ZhDq4fMqaKtM3NCGb
  • b5156fe81f89f81771fc367505aa3e1a1f96f68ae49644a343d7ff7f01968245:1
  • value  42595908
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